Output 51258c50f2d73501ea304fd2015d8ae95f831ea28bcde850d0cf0345020f8c13:3

value
224206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e174c1a33b11ef1d58622efff830207ff53255f OP_EQUAL
address
35tiv6EKvXcVq7nxGxzvWTURKEtuB2EcQe
transaction
51258c50f2d73501ea304fd2015d8ae95f831ea28bcde850d0cf0345020f8c13
confirmations
164915
spent
true